This role involves managing and coordinating remedial maintenance work by serving as the main contact point, organising repairs through direct labour or subcontractors while meeting customer SLAs, and ordering necessary parts and equipment.

What you will be doing:

  • Process requests for quotations (RFQs) for remedial works, repairs, and maintenance across building portfolios.
  • Coordinate with approved suppliers and service providers to obtain competitive quotes.
  • Review and analyse quotes for accuracy, completeness, and compliance with specifications.
  • Ensure quotes include appropriate scope of works, materials, labour costs, and timelines.
  • Review building defect reports, condition assessments, and maintenance logs to determine required works.
  • Interpret technical specifications and translate them into clear scope requirements for customers.
  • Verify that quoted works align with identified defects and compliance requirements.
  • Assess reasonableness of pricing against market rates and historical data.
  • Communicate with suppliers and clients to clarify scope, answer questions, and negotiate pricing.
  • Present quote comparisons and recommendations to clients and decision-makers.
  • Maintain regular updates on quote status and any issues affecting timelines.
  • Maintain accurate records of all quotes, correspondence, and approvals in relevant systems.
  • Ensure quotes meet regulatory requirements and client standards.
  • Document variations and changes to original scope.
  • Identify opportunities to streamline the quotation process.
  • Build and maintain relationships with reliable supplier networks.
  • Contribute to development of standard specifications and pricing benchmarks.

At Hall & Kay, we deliver complex fire protection and security solutions to protect what matters most to our clients. As technical experts our focus is on the lifetime value of a project. Meaning we can design, supply, install, test and maintain all types of sprinkler, gas suppression, fire detection, and integrated security systems. With 140+ year trading experience and a strong project delivery culture, we are proud to have built lasting relationships with some of the UK's most respected companies in all areas of industry and construction.
